Frolic in the heavenly garden, or feed the animals on the farm by day, and curl up in front of the wood burner in the cosy sitting room by night. The Hideaway is a stylish and elegant two bedroom luxury cottage in a pretty countryside setting.
The spacious open plan kitchen/dining room with original flagstone floors and underfloor heating has floor to ceiling windows and French doors to show off the every changing countryside that surrounds. Upstairs you’ll find a lovely master bedroom with four poster bed and those amazing views again. There is also a twin room and the family bathroom.
Even though completely set on its own for privacy, walk over the heath a couple of hundred yards and you will come to the farm that The Hideaway is part of. The unique thing about staying here is that there is a stunning recently renovated chill-out barn that is shared with a few glamping tents and another cottage. A great place to chill out, it has Sky TV, a library, games, a lounge and dining area, the all-important honesty bar, fire-place, farm shop and local award winning tea and coffee (and sometimes even cake!). The owners also offer anything from yummy daily breakfasts and communal dinners 3 times a week made from fresh farm produce. Well behaved dogs welcome!
Staying here you can expect a truly spectacular rural setting, off the beaten track, where the stars shine bright at night. Nestled at the foothills of the Black Mountains, only a stone’s throw from famous Hay-on-Wye and the Brecon Beacons National Park, so if you can manage to drag yourself away from the farm, there is plenty to do in the area.
